At the University of Konstanz, students can take courses in computational linguistics as part of the BA in Linguistics. In terms of MA studies in computational linguistics, we offer a degree that includes machine as well as human language processing. This MA is called Speech and Language Processing (SLP). Some answers to frequently asked questions are provided here.

If you would like to do a PhD in computational linguistics, you can apply to be part of the program structured linguistics PhD program.


Here at our laboratory we offer a variety of practical oriented courses in computational or experimental lingustics. The following list shows a few courses that are taught regularly in computational linguistics:

  • Argumentation & Computers
  • Computational Semantics
  • Corpus Linguistics
  • Distributional Semantics
  • Finite State Morphology
  • Grammar Development
  • Lexical-Functional Grammar
  • Linguistic Gaming with Python
  • Machine Learning
  • Machine Translation
  • Perl for Linguists
  • Python for Linguists
  • Statistics (R)